天津市宁河区辣椒炭疽病病原鉴定及防治药剂筛选
Identification of Pepper Anthracnose and Screening of Fungicides Against It in Ninghe of Tianjin
【摘要】 以从天津市宁河区采集的辣椒炭疽病病样为试材,通过形态学与对病菌核糖体DNA的ITS区分析相结合的方法对引起该病的病原进行鉴定,采用菌丝生长速率法测定了12种杀菌剂对病原菌的室内抑菌效果。结果表明:天津市宁河区辣椒主产区的辣椒炭疽病病原为尖孢炭疽菌和平头炭疽菌,二者的分离比率为0.711∶0.289。室内药剂筛选结果表明,咪鲜胺、咯菌腈、多菌灵和吡唑醚菌酯对尖孢炭疽菌菌丝抑制效果较好,其EC50值分别为0.022 8、0.123 2、0.361 2、0.716 8μg·mL-1;咪鲜胺、咯菌腈和多菌灵对平头炭疽菌菌丝抑制效果较好,其EC50值分别为0.066 7、0.193 7、0.240 0μg·mL-1。咪鲜胺、咯菌腈、多菌灵和吡唑醚菌酯可以作为防治辣椒炭疽病的候选药剂。
【Abstract】 Pepper infected by Colletotrichum spp.in Ninghe,Tianjin was taken as experimental material,the pathogen by a combination of morphology and ribosomal DNA internal transcribed spacer regin(ITS)was identified,and twelve kinds of fungicides against the disease by plate method in the laboratary were screened.The results showed that the pathogen which infected pepper in Ninghe district was C.acutatumand C.truncatum,which segregation ratio was 0.711∶0.289,respectively.The results of fungicides screening in laboratory indicate,prochloraz,fludioxonil,carbendazim and pyradostrobin had better inhibitory effect on the growth of mycelium of C.acutatum,which EC50 values were 0.022 8,0.123 2,0.361 2,0.716 8μg·mL-1,respectively.Prochloraz,fludioxonil and carbendazim had better inhibitory effect on the growth of mycelium of C.truncatum,which EC50 values were 0.066 7,0.193 7,0.240 0μg· mL-1,respectively.Therefore,prochloraz,fludioxonil,carbendazim and pyraclostrobin could be used as chemicals to control the disease.
